Origins and Family

Francis Childers was born on +1607-07-03T00:00:00Z[2]. His father was Hugh Childers[3]. His mother was Margaret Hardy[4].

Personal Life

Spouses include unknown wife (?)[5] and Elizabeth Bowier[6]. Children include Winifred Childers[7]; Frances Childers[8]; and Thomas Childers[9], 1648–1676[16].
